mysql8.0.20 herunterladen und installieren und aufgetretene Probleme (Abbildung und Text)

mysql8.0.20 herunterladen und installieren und aufgetretene Probleme (Abbildung und Text)

1. Suchen Sie im Browser nach MySQL, um es herunterzuladen und zu installieren

Adresse: https://dev.mysql.com/downloads/mysql/

2. Download mit oder ohne Anmeldung

3. Bei der heruntergeladenen Datei handelt es sich um ein komprimiertes Paket, das ohne Installation direkt entpackt werden kann.

4. Erstellen Sie eine neue my.ini Datei mit folgendem Inhalt

In Bezug auf den SQL-Modus liegt der folgende Fehler daran, dass das Gruppierungsfeld vollständig in der Abfragespalte angezeigt werden muss. Wenn Sie diesen Modus entfernen, tritt also kein Fehler auf.

Ursache: java.sql.SQLSyntaxErrorException: Ausdruck Nr. 13 der SELECT-Liste ist nicht in der GROUP BY-Klausel enthalten und enthält eine nicht aggregierte Spalte .........., die nicht funktional von Spalten in der GROUP BY-Klausel abhängig ist; dies ist nicht kompatibel mit sql_mode=only_full_group_by

5. Installieren und konfigurieren Sie dann das MySQL-Verzeichnis im Pfad der Systemumgebungsvariablen. Dies ist optional, aber wenn es konfiguriert ist, können Sie MySQL direkt in die DOS-Schnittstelle eingeben.

6. Verwenden Sie den Administratorbefehlsmodus auf dem Computer, um das Verzeichnis mysql / bin aufzurufen und die Installation von mysql zu initialisieren

Wenn Sie nach der Eingabe den Laufwerksbuchstaben wechseln müssen, wechseln Sie einfach mit d: und dann mit cd mysql directory/bin in das Bin-Verzeichnis.

Geben Sie dann ein:

1) mysqld --initialize --console, dieser Befehl initialisiert die Datei my.ini, erstellt das Datenverzeichnis und nimmt andere Einstellungen vor. Markieren Sie das untenstehende Passwort mit der Maus und drücken Sie Strg+C, um es zu kopieren.

Beachten Sie hierbei, dass Sie, wenn die Datei my.ini später geändert wird und die Änderungen nach einem Neustart von MySQL nicht wirksam werden, das Datenverzeichnis und den MySQL-Dienst löschen, den Befehl „sc delete service name“ verwenden und den Befehl anschließend erneut ausführen müssen.

2) Geben Sie ein: mysqld --install

3) Eingabe: net start mysql Wenn mysql lokal installiert wurde, können Sie hier den Dienstnamen ändern, z. B. mysql8. Bei meinem Test, als mysql5.5 bereits lokal vorhanden war, installierte ich mysql8 und das gelesene Passwort war immer noch das Anmeldepasswort von mysql5.5. Dann löschte ich mysql5.5 und installierte mysql8 normal.

6. Anmelden und Passwort ändern

Win+R, wechseln Sie in den Befehlszeilenmodus und geben Sie Folgendes ein: mysql -u root -p Wenn der Pfad zuvor nicht hinzugefügt wurde, müssen Sie hier das MySQL-Bin-Verzeichnis eingeben

Geben Sie das in Schritt 5 kopierte Passwort ein und geben Sie mysql ein

Ausführen: Benutzer „root@localhost“ ändern, identifiziert durch „root“. Drücken Sie die Eingabetaste, um das Passwort erfolgreich in „root“ zu ändern. Vergessen Sie nicht das Semikolon nach der SQL-Anweisung.

Zusammenfassen

Dies ist das Ende dieses Artikels über den Download und die Installation von mysql8.0.20 und die aufgetretenen Probleme. Weitere relevante Inhalte zum Download und zur Installation von mysql8.0.20 finden Sie in früheren Artikeln auf 123WORDPRESS.COM oder durchsuchen Sie die verwandten Artikel weiter unten. Ich hoffe, dass jeder 123WORDPRESS.COM in Zukunft unterstützen wird!

Das könnte Sie auch interessieren:
  • Tutorial zur Installation und Konfiguration von MySQL 8.0.12 unter Win10
  • MySQL 5.6.23 Installations- und Konfigurations-Umgebungsvariablen-Tutorial
  • So konfigurieren Sie Umgebungsvariablen nach der Installation der MySQL5.7-Datenbank
  • Die neueste Version von MySQL 8.0.22 herunterladen und installieren - super ausführliches Tutorial (Windows 64 Bit)
  • Grafisches Tutorial zum Herunterladen, Installieren und Konfigurieren von MySQL 8.0.22.0
  • Grafisches Tutorial zum Herunterladen, Installieren und Konfigurieren von MySQL 8.0.22
  • Detailliertes Tutorial zum Herunterladen, Installieren und Konfigurieren von MySQL 5.7.27
  • MySQL 5.6.37 (zip) Download Installationskonfiguration Grafik-Tutorial
  • MySQL 5.7.18 Green Edition Download- und Installations-Tutorial
  • Das ausführliche Tutorial zum Herunterladen und Installieren von MySQL 8.0.15 ist für Anfänger ein Muss!
  • MySQL 8.0.13 Download- und Installations-Tutorial mit Bildern und Text
  • Zusammenfassung häufiger Probleme beim Herunterladen und Installieren von MySQL 5.7 unter Win7 64-Bit
  • Detaillierte grafische Anweisungen zum Herunterladen und Installieren der entpackten Version von MySQL 5.7.18 und zum Starten des MySQL-Dienstes
  • Grafisches Tutorial zum Herunterladen und Installieren des MySQL 5.7-Dienstes (Classic Edition)
  • MySQL 5.7.14: ausführliches Tutorial zum Herunterladen, Installieren, Konfigurieren und Verwenden
  • MySQL MSI-Version herunterladen und installieren - ausführliches grafisches Tutorial für Anfänger

<<:  So starten Sie das Spring-Boot-Projekt mit dem integrierten Linux-System in Win10

>>:  Tutorial zum binären Suchbaumalgorithmus für JavaScript-Anfänger

Artikel empfehlen

Tutorial zu HTML-Tabellen-Tags (34): Zeilenspannen-Attribut ROWSPAN

In einer komplexen Tabellenstruktur erstrecken si...

Beispiel für die Bereitstellungsmethode „Forever+nginx“ einer Node-Site

Ich habe vor Kurzem den günstigsten Tencent-Cloud...

Führen Sie die Schritte zur Verwendung des Elements in vue3.0 aus

Vorwort: Verwenden Sie das Element-Framework in v...

HTML-Tabellen-Markup-Tutorial (18): Tabellenkopf

<br />Die Kopfzeile bezieht sich auf die ers...

jquery+springboot realisiert die Datei-Upload-Funktion

In diesem Artikelbeispiel wird der spezifische Co...

Sprechen Sie kurz über MySQL Left Join Inner Join

Vorwort Ich war kürzlich damit beschäftigt, ein K...

MySQL verwendet SQL-Anweisungen zum Ändern von Tabellennamen

In MySQL können Sie die SQL-Anweisung „rename tab...

Lösen Sie das Installationsproblem von Linux Tensorflow2.0

conda aktualisieren conda pip installieren tf-nig...

Python 3.7-Installationstutorial für MacBook

Der detaillierte Prozess der Installation von Pyt...

Vue echarts realisiert horizontales Balkendiagramm

In diesem Artikel wird der spezifische Code von V...

MySQL-Gruppe durch Gruppieren mehrerer Felder

Bei täglichen Entwicklungsaufgaben verwenden wir ...

Prinzip und Anwendungsbeispiele des URL-Umschreibmechanismus von Nginx

Durch das Umschreiben der URL lässt sich die bevo...

Detaillierte Analyse des Explain-Ausführungsplans in MySQL

Vorwort Das Schreiben effizienter SQL-Anweisungen...